Paris Saint-Germain are interested in Arsenal defender Gabriel Magalhães.

THE LOWDOWN: MUCH INTEREST

The Brazilian has enjoyed a sparkling season for the Gunners, both defensively and offensively, contributing to 12 clean sheets from 35 games played and also chipping in with an impressive five goals scored, the most of any centre-back in the Premier League.

The former LOSC Lille man has been subject to much interest in recent months, with European giants Barcelona and Juventus all previously linked with his services.

Recent reports have even stated that the Gunners will be willing to let the Brazilian leave the club, if an attractive offer arrives. And it seems that may come in the form of French Ligue 1 champions PSG.

THE LATEST: PSG INTEREST

According to Tuttomercatoweb, PSG are interested in Arsenal defender Gabriel Magalhaes should they fail to reach an agreement with Inter Milan over Milan Skriniar.

The report claims that the French outfit who are now under new recruitment stewardship in famous football advisor Luis Campos, have listed the Gunners defender as a viable alternative should they fail to sign the Slovakian international.

THE VERDICT: KEEP AT ALL COSTS

The uncapped Brazilian has enjoyed an impressive season at the Emirates, forming a solid centre-back partnership with Ben White.

The £27m-rated defender was rewarded with an impressive SofaScore rating of 7.02 for his performances, ranking as the second-best player in the Gunners camp.

In 35 league starts, he hit five goals, contributed to 12 clean sheets, averaged 0.4 interceptions, 1.4 tackles per game and also winning 69% of his ground duels and 60% of his aerial duels, highlighting just how crucial he’s been to Mikel Arteta’s defence this season.

He also ranks third in the English top-flight for percentage of dribblers tackled at 65.7% showing just how combative and colossal he is when facing up against his opponents.

With the £51k-per-week star at the heart of the north London outfit’s defence, Arteta’s men are guaranteed security at the back showing just why they must keep the Brazilian at all costs this summer.
